Looking relaxed and at ease after their 10-day spaceflight, five of the STS-79 astronauts pose for a group portrait with NASA Administrator Daniel Goldin. From left are Mission Specialist Jay Apt; Pilot Terrence W. Wilcutt; Goldin; Commander William F. Readdy; and Mission Specialists Thomas D. Akers and Carl E. Walz. Behind them, post landing activities continue on the orbiter Atlantis, which touched down on KSC's Runway 15 at 8:13:15 a.m. EDT to conclude Mission STS-79. Not shown is U.S. astronaut Shannon W. Lucid, who returned to Earth with the STS-79 flight crew after a record breaking stay aboard the Russian Space Station Mir.
